Secure POP for Eudora
As of December 12th, 2007, NSIT will no longer support Eudora. This program was discontinued by its manufacturer, Qualcomm. While Eudora may continue to work with NSIT's servers, we cannot guarantee reliable performance. This walkthrough is provided as a courtesy only.

Configuration Instructions
To connect with NSIT email servers, use Eudora version 6.2 or higher. These instructions were written with Eudora 6.2 in mind. They assume they you have just installed Eudora and have not configured anything yet. To get started, open Eudora.
- You may get prompted by a dialog box asking if you want to use the system keychain to store your passwords. Click Yes.

- Next, you may be askd if you would like to import settings and mailboxes from another email program. Click No.

- Now Eudora will display the Settings window. Click on the "Getting Started" choice in the left sidebar. Enter the server information, email addresses, and other information as pictured.

- Click on the "Checking Mail" category.

- For the Mail Protocol, select POP. Make sure to fill in pop.uchicago.edu
- Scroll down the list of categories in the left sidebar until you see the "SSL" choice. Click on it.

- Change SSL for SMTP to "Required (Alternate Port)".
- Change SSL for POP to "Required (Alternate Port)".
- Click OK to save your Settings.
- Now attempt to check your mail Eudora by going up to File → Check Mail, or by clicking on the Check Mail icon.
- Eudora will prompt you for your password. Enter your password and click OK.
- Eudora may prompt you to accept a security certificate and add it to your keychain. Click OK. Your mail will begin to load.
Eudora is now configured to check email securely on NSIT email servers!
